✦ Synopsis
A phase diagram for unpoled ceramics in the lead-free (1 -x)(Bi 1/2 Na 1/2 )TiO 3 -xBaTiO 3 binary system is constructed for the first time based on transmission electron microscopy (TEM) and dielectric study. In contrast to the reported phase diagram determined using poled ceramics, an additional phase region exhibiting P4bm nanodomains was revealed. A new concept ''relaxor antiferroelectric'' was proposed to describe the unique short-range antiferroelectric order of this phase. The results suggest that electric fieldinduced phase transitions must be taken into consideration in optimizing the piezoelectric properties in these lead-free ceramics.
